Selecting the Best Business Format : Limited vs. LLP, OPC, & Single Owner Business
Deciding on the suitable legal structure for your venture can be tricky . Limited companies offer enhanced liability protection and simpler fundraising, while a Limited Liability Partnership (LLP) merges the flexibility of a partnership with limited liability. An One Person Company (OPC) is intended for single entrepreneurs needing corporate benefits, and a classic Sole Proprietorship remains the simplest to establish, though with full personal liability. The optimal choice depends on factors like liability concerns , capital needs , and your overall goals .

One Person Company Registration: Benefits and Process Explained
Registering a one-person company, often called an OPC, provides a multitude of advantages to entrepreneurs . This framework allows a solitary individual to enjoy the limitation of a corporate entity while maintaining full control. The procedure typically involves getting a Digital Signature Certificate (DSC) and a Director Identification Number (DIN), followed by preparing the Memorandum of Association (MoA) and Articles of Association (AoA). Subsequently, you must lodge the application with the Registrar of Companies (ROC) and remit the requisite fees . Once cleared, the OPC is legally registered, enabling the owner to conduct business operations in their own name with enhanced reputation and liability protection.
